Most popular baby girl names in Vermont in 2000

In Vermont in the year 2000, the most popular baby girl names were Emily, Olivia, Abigail, Emma, and Hannah. Emily was the most popular name with 69 babies given that name, followed by Olivia with 51, Abigail with 48, and Emma and Hannah tied with 46 each.

Most popular baby boy names in Vermont in 2000

In Vermont in the year 2000, the most popular names for baby boys were Jacob, Matthew, Ryan, Michael, and Tyler. Jacob was the most popular name, with 79 babies being given that name. Matthew came in second with 61 babies, followed closely by Ryan with 59 babies. Michael and Tyler rounded out the top five with 52 and 51 babies given those names, respectively.
